CHANDERI

Chanderi is a graceful handloom tradition from the historic town of Chanderi in Madhya Pradesh, loved for its feather-light feel, sheer texture, and soft natural sheen. Its delicate transparency and fluid drape give it an understated richness that feels both festive and effortless.

Traditionally woven with fine silk, cotton, and zari, Chanderi sarees often carry motifs inspired by nature, temple art, and Mughal architecture. Light yet luxurious, a Chanderi is made for moments that ask for elegance without heaviness.
